Abstract

The invention, in a first aspect, provides a hopper capable of agitating concrete. The hopper comprises a hopper body, wherein an agitating shaft driven by a hydraulic motor is rotationally mounted in the hopper body; an intermediate thumb wheel is fixedly mounted at the intermediate position of the agitating shaft; two sides of the intermediate thumb wheel are provided with a left helical blade and a right helical blade, which are inverse in rotation directions, respectively; certain ends, which approach the intermediate thumb wheel, of the left helical blade and the right helical blade are fixedly mounted on the intermediate thumb wheel; the other end of the left helical blade is fixedly mounted at the left end part of the agitating shaft; the other end of the right helical blade is fixedly mounted at the right end part of the agitating shaft; a left material passing-through clearance is arranged between the left helical blade and the agitating shaft; and a right material passing-through clearance is arranged between the right helical blade and the agitating shaft. By using the hopper, a plurality of beneficial effects that the agitation is uniform, the agitation efficiency is improved, the structure of the agitating shaft is changed, the service life is prolonged, and the like, can be obtained; and the hopper is widely applied to engineering machinery.

Background technology
At building construction, road performance building site and fertilizer, feedstuff, the industry such as brewage, be required for mixing material.At present, conventional alr mode has: 1, artificial mix: but this method also exists many defects such as labor intensity is big, inefficiency, mix are uneven.2, hand stock, blender mix: this method is by artificial or human assistance feeding, and labor intensity is the biggest, and blender is fixing and transition inconvenience, these defects significantly limit its application.3 special fixing blender mixs: this mode can only special computer for special use, it is impossible to large-scale promotion uses.4, mixing plant and trucd mixer: this mode needs special place and the biggest equipment investment, and can only fix use, for the aspect existing defects such as actionradius, convenience.
In order to overcome these defects, generally using loader more efficiently when concrete ships, but traditional loader can only simply shovel dress and transport, and do not have agitating function, function is more single.Therefore some manufacturers have carried out further improvement to loader so that it is function is more comprehensive, such as:
CN105133684A discloses a kind of mixing bucket, and it is used as the scraper bowl of loader or excavator, and described mixing bucket includes that scraper bowl, shaft assembly and hydraulic motor, described shaft assembly are connected with hydraulic motor, and shaft assembly is placed in scraper bowl.This mixing bucket is used on loader or excavator, at operation field, to the material needing mix, it is possible to achieve superfast loading, mixes thoroughly, carry and unloads, a tractor serves several purposes, quickness and high efficiency, convenient and strength-saving.
CN204486458U discloses a kind of for soil remediation sieving approach mix and blend scraper bowl, it includes bucket body, the lateral symmetry of bucket body installs line shaft bearing sum driven shaft bearing, it is respectively mounted bearing in described line shaft bearing and driven shaft bearing, by bearing holder (housing, cover) equipped with rotary shaft in described line shaft bearing, described rotary shaft is connected with hydraulic motor by shaft coupling, between the driven shaft bearing that the left and right sides is relative, roller bearing is installed, the termination of described rotary shaft and the termination of roller bearing are mounted on sprocket wheel, it is positioned between the adjacent sprocket wheel of bucket body wherein side and is connected with each other by roller chain, some groups of projections axially it are installed with along roller bearing, it is arranged on the same sagittal plane of roller bearing, the position interlaced arrangement of adjacent projections group.ThisInventionPosition relationship between middle roller bearing upper protruding block is conducive to crushing soil and sieving, and the mode beneficially soil of discharging limit, limit spray medicine is fully contacted reaction with medicament, at utmost plays repair materials usefulness.
CN104787504A discloses the repacking hopper of a kind of blender, and this hopper converts on the basis of climbing bucket concrete mixer, and the position of repacking is the charging aperture of hopper, discharging opening and bucket body three part.The angle iron frame of charging aperture being changed into tubular framework, the square discharging opening below original hopper is made circle or oval, the bucket body part machining deformation to hopper, the hopper after repacking is the infundibular body of a square top and round bottom.Setting up on hopper after repacking and cut open cutter, cut open the blade of cutter upwards, bagged cement is cut under the impact of gravity, and cement is wandered in hopper, the empty bag of residual cut open on cutter by manually pick up tremble clean after reclaim.
CN103921355A discloses a kind of mixing plant and holds together hopper, including a cone barrel, it is provided with feed opening in the bottom of cone barrel, four arc notch of the same size circumferentially it are uniformly provided with on the top of cone barrel, a striker plate being vertically arranged it is respectively provided with at each arc notch, the end vertical of adjacent two striker plates welds mutually, four pieces of striker plates surround the square charging aperture matched with the square installing port on the platform of mixing plant, conical barrel top between adjacent two arc notch is provided with a sealing plate with the gap being located between the biphase striker plate welded at this two arc notch.Its reasonable in design, use cone barrel, its inner surface is arc-shaped, there is not discharging dead angle, avoid concrete and stick in barrel, it is ensured that the normal blanking of cone barrel, additionally, set up removable arc liner plate in cone barrel lower inside, substantially prolongs the service life of hopper.
As mentioned above, prior art discloses the multiple mixing bucket/hopper with agitating function, but the mixing bucket of these types still suffer from actual use stirring and uneven, stirring efficiency is relatively low, shaft works long hours the defect such as is easily broken off, thus cannot large-scale use, the most still cannot be promoted.

As Figure 1Figure 2Figure 3WithFigure 4Figure 5nullShown in common,The invention discloses a kind of can the hopper of ready-mixed concrete,Including bucket body 1,The shaft 2 driven by hydraulic motor 3 it is rotatablely equipped with in bucket body 1,The centre position of shaft 2 is installed with a middle thumb wheel 6,The both sides of middle thumb wheel 6 are respectively arranged with oppositely oriented left-hand screw blade 4 and right-hand screw blade 5,Left-hand screw blade 4 and right-hand screw blade 5 are fixedly installed on middle thumb wheel 6 near one end of middle thumb wheel 6,The other end of left-hand screw blade 4 is fixedly installed in the left part of shaft 2,The other end of right-hand screw blade 5 is fixedly installed in the right part of shaft 2,Left punishment in advance gap it is provided with between left-hand screw blade 4 and shaft 2,Right punishment in advance gap it is provided with between right-hand screw blade 5 and shaft 2,Shaft 2 is when hydraulic motor 3 is rotated by,Left-hand screw blade 4 and right-hand screw blade 5 can push the concrete in bucket body 1 to both sides,Laterally stir,And in shaft 2 rotation process,Concrete can pass through from left punishment in advance gap and right punishment in advance gap,Reduce the material impact to shaft 2,This structure makes service life of shaft 2 longer,And left-hand screw blade 4 and right-hand screw blade 5 are while laterally agitation concrete,Concrete can also be stirred up and down,So that concrete-agitating is more uniform,Improve mixing effect.
Described left-hand screw blade 4 is fixedly installed on left-hand screw beam 14, and one end of left-hand screw beam 14 is fixedly installed on middle thumb wheel 6 by securing member, and the other end is fixedly installed in the left part of shaft 2, forms left punishment in advance gap between left-hand screw beam 14 and shaft 2;Right-hand screw blade 5 is fixedly installed on right-hand screw beam 16, one end of right-hand screw beam 16 is fixedly installed on middle thumb wheel 6 by securing member, the other end is fixedly installed in the right part of shaft 2, right punishment in advance gap is formed between right-hand screw beam 16 and shaft 2, the intensity of left-hand screw beam 14 and right-hand screw beam 16 is high, is primarily subjected to the moment of torsion of circumferencial direction in the direction of the width, it is not easy to deform, rigidity is relatively good, the force environment that applicable sandstone, concrete are complicated, severe.
Some left-leaning reinforcements 15 it are provided with between described left-hand screw blade 4 and left-hand screw beam 14, some Right deviation reinforcements 17 it are provided with between right-hand screw blade 5 and right-hand screw beam 16, left-leaning reinforcement 15 and Right deviation reinforcement 17 1 aspect play fixation, left-hand screw blade 4 and left-hand screw beam 14 are firmly combined with, right-hand screw blade 5 and right-hand screw beam 16 are firmly combined with, on the other hand, rotation along with shaft 2, also produce a horizontal force, promotion concrete is toward two side shiftings, and then improves mixing effect.
Described middle thumb wheel 6 is as a critical component, fixing left-hand screw beam 14 and the effect of right-hand screw beam 16 is played in bucket body 1, its cross section is impacted by material, thus the burden of shaft 2 can be increased, inventor is through further investigation, the some herringbone convex tendons 601 of surface configuration of shaft 2 axis it are parallel at middle thumb wheel 6, when shaft 2 rotates, material can be divided the left and right sides to middle thumb wheel 6, reduce the material impact to shaft 2, and then effectively extend the service life of shaft 2.
Being mounted on bearing box 22 on the two side of described bucket body 1, be provided with bearing chamber in bearing box 22, be provided with bearing 8 in bearing chamber, shaft 2 is installed on bearing 8, and hydraulic motor 3 is positioned at the outside of bucket body 1 and is installed on bearing box 22.Certainly, as required, hydraulic motor 3 can arrange two, is respectively mounted one on the bearing box 22 of bucket body 1 both sides.
Described bearing box 22 is provided with a machine jacket 9 near one end of middle thumb wheel 6, mechanical sealing assembly 10 is installed in machine jacket 9, machine jacket 9 is provided with outside framework oil seal 11, outside framework oil seal 11 is between bearing 8 and mechanical sealing assembly 10, mechanical sealing assembly 10 is existing accessory, can directly purchase, it is installed and using method is well known to those skilled in the art, and does not repeats them here.
The two ends of described shaft 2 all fixedly mount a thumb wheel cover 7, the shape of thumb wheel cover 7 is the frustum of hollow, thumb wheel cover 7 is buckled in the outside of machine jacket 9, the end face of thumb wheel cover 7 and the contacted inner surfaces of bucket body 1 sidewall, left-hand screw beam 14 and right-hand screw beam 16 are fixedly installed on the thumb wheel cover 7 of correspondence respectively, left-hand screw leaf Sheet 4 and right-hand screw blade 5 are defined as head end near one end of middle thumb wheel 6, the other end is tail end, left-hand screw blade 4 extends on the end face of thumb wheel cover 7, and the tail end of left-hand screw blade 4 is provided with blade 18, blade 18 leans with the sidewall of bucket body 1, is possible to prevent material to be stuck between the sidewall of bucket body 1 and left-hand screw blade 4, and play the effect of scraper, in like manner, right-hand screw blade 5 extends on the end face of corresponding thumb wheel cover 7, and the tail end of right-hand screw blade 5 is provided with blade 18.
Described thumb wheel cover 7 runs through and is provided with water inlet pipe 12 and outlet pipe 13, the port of water inlet pipe 12 and outlet pipe 13 may be contained within thumb wheel cover 7, specifically, the outlet of water inlet pipe 12 is positioned at the bottom position of thumb wheel cover 7, and the water inlet of outlet pipe 13 is positioned at the tip position of thumb wheel cover 7, so so that storages the most in thumb wheel cover 7 cools down water, fully to carry out heat exchange, reduce the temperature of bearing 8, on the other hand, can also wash away penetrating into the small material entered, keep the cleaning in thumb wheel cover 7, extend potted component and the service life of bearing 8.
The inner surface of described bucket body 1 is provided with wearing layer 21, the main material of wearing layer 21 is 1Cr13 rustless steel, the most described main material comprises the calcium sulfate crystal whiskers of 0.03-0.05% weight, by the addition of calcium sulfate crystal whiskers, its intensity, wearability and corrosion resistance can be dramatically increased, thus significantly extend the service life of hopper.
The open-mouth of described bucket body 1 is provided with grid 19, one end of grid 19 is hingedly mounted on bucket body 1, hydraulic driving element can be connected, can also be manually opened, those skilled in the art can arrange as required, grid 19 is provided with the sharp knife 20 being easy to cut open cement pocket, sharp knife 20 is positioned at the middle part of grid 19, the point of a knife of sharp knife 20 protrudes from the upper surface of grid 19, during shovel material, grid 19 closes, both the effect of safety guard can have been played, can conveniently cut open again cement pocket, the size of sandstone can also be limited during shovel material, to guarantee to be uniformly mixed, improve the quality of concrete.
